Dollar-Cost Averaging (DCA): A Strategic Approach to Investment
Dollar-value averaging (DCA) is a famous investment method that includes making an investment of a set amount of money in Bitcoin at normal intervals, regardless of its rate fluctuations. This method enables the elimination of the effect of market volatility and decreases the danger of marketplace timing mistakes.
By constantly investing in Bitcoin through the years, buyers can accumulate more of the asset at lower costs at some stage in market downturns and benefit from its ability to appreciate over time. DCA is an easy yet effective approach for milking earnings from Bitcoin investments and optimizing returns over the long term.
Holling for the Long Term
“HODLing,” a period derived from a misspelling of “hold,” refers to the strategy of holding onto Bitcoin for the long term, no matter quick-time period charge fluctuations. While day trading and short-term period speculation can also yield earnings for some investors, HODLing is an approach favored by many Bitcoin enthusiasts who accept it as true within the cryptocurrency’s lengthy-term capacity as a store of value and hedge in opposition to inflation.
By holding onto Bitcoin for the long term, buyers can gain from its scarcity and growing adoption, doubtlessly understanding huge profits as its fee appreciates through the years. Moreover, Holling reduces the temptation to engage in impulsive buying and selling and lets traders become conscious of their long-term funding dreams.
Risk Management and Portfolio Diversification
While Bitcoin holds full-size potential for earnings, buyers need to control their chances effectively and diversify their funding portfolios. Investing in Bitcoin incorporates inherent dangers, including charge volatility, regulatory uncertainty, and technological dangers. By imposing chance management techniques and diversifying through unique asset lessons, investors can mitigate capability losses and optimize their typical returns.
Moreover, keep in mind allocating the most effective portion of your investment capital to Bitcoin and diversifying across other cryptocurrencies, stocks, bonds, real estate, and alternative investments. By spreading chance across distinctive properties, buyers can lessen their publicity of any unmarried asset magnificence and construct a more resilient investment portfolio.
